Effective ESOL Strategies For Language Learners

English for Speakers of Other Languages (ESOL) programs are designed to help non-native English speakers improve their language skills Whether students are beginners or more advanced, there are a variety of strategies that can be implemented to enhance their learning experience In this article, we will discuss some effective ESOL strategies that can benefit language learners.

One of the key strategies in ESOL instruction is to create a supportive and inclusive learning environment Language learners often feel self-conscious and nervous about speaking in a new language, so it is important to foster a safe space where they feel comfortable practicing and making mistakes Teachers can achieve this by encouraging participation, showing patience, and providing positive reinforcement Building a strong sense of community within the classroom can help students feel more motivated and engaged in their learning.

Another important strategy is to incorporate a variety of teaching methods to cater to different learning styles Some students may learn best through visual aids, while others may prefer hands-on activities or auditory learning By using a mix of approaches such as group work, discussions, games, and multimedia resources, teachers can appeal to a diverse range of students and keep lessons dynamic and engaging Flexibility in teaching methods can help accommodate the needs of each individual learner and facilitate a more effective learning experience.

In addition, scaffolding is a valuable strategy in ESOL instruction that involves breaking down complex tasks into manageable steps By providing clear instructions, modeling tasks, and offering support as needed, teachers can help students gradually build their language skills and confidence Scaffolding allows learners to take on more challenging tasks over time, while still receiving the guidance they need to succeed This incremental approach can help students feel less overwhelmed and more empowered in their language learning journey.

Language learners need ample opportunities to practice new vocabulary, grammar, and pronunciation in order to internalize and retain them By incorporating regular review activities, drills, and exercises that reinforce key concepts, teachers can help students strengthen their skills and build fluency Repetition is especially important for language learners as it helps to solidify their understanding and mastery of the English language.

Furthermore, differentiation is a crucial strategy in ESOL instruction that involves tailoring lessons to meet the individual needs of students Teachers should assess the proficiency levels, interests, and learning goals of their students and adjust their instruction accordingly This may involve providing additional support for struggling students, offering extension activities for advanced learners, or adapting materials to accommodate different learning styles By personalizing the learning experience, teachers can better meet the diverse needs of their students and help them reach their full potential.

Technology can also be a valuable tool in ESOL instruction Online resources, language learning apps, and interactive software can provide additional support and practice opportunities for students outside of the classroom Teachers can incorporate technology into their lessons to enhance engagement, promote independent learning, and expose students to authentic language materials By integrating technology into their instruction, teachers can cater to the digital native generation and help students develop their language skills in the digital age.

In conclusion, effective ESOL strategies can help language learners improve their English proficiency and achieve their learning goals By creating a supportive learning environment, incorporating diverse teaching methods, scaffolding tasks, providing repetition and reinforcement, differentiating instruction, and utilizing technology, teachers can enhance the language learning experience for their students With the right strategies in place, ESOL programs can empower students to communicate confidently in English and succeed in their academic and professional pursuits.
